How to fill out the Notice Of Commencement Lead Abatement/Mitigation Project - Idph State Il online
Filling out the Notice of Commencement for lead abatement or mitigation projects is an essential step in ensuring compliance with Illinois regulations. This guide will walk you through each section of the form, providing clear instructions and support for a smooth online application process.

- Begin with Section 1, where you will enter the IDPH License Lead Contractor ID#. Ensure that you have your contractor's ID number at hand.
- In Section 2, input the IDPH License Lead Contractor Name. This must match the name listed on the license, confirming they are authorized to conduct the project.
- In Section 3, provide the Name of the Building where the project will take place. Accurately enter the official name as recognized.
- Continue with Section 4 to 8, noting the Address, City, State, ZIP Code, and Phone Number of the building. Each detail is crucial for proper identification.
- Choose the Type of Building from the given options in Section 9. Select the appropriate category that describes the property.
- In Section 10, fill in the Property Owner's Name and their available Phone Number, ensuring correct spelling for clarity.
- If the Owner's Address differs from the property address, enter it in the provided space in Section 11.
- Complete Section 12 with the Start Date of the project and Section 13 with the anticipated Completion Date.
- Fill in Sections 14 and 15 with the Start Time and Completion Time of the project. Accurate timing is essential for regulatory purposes.
- In Section 16, describe the project clearly and concisely. This description helps to provide context for the work being undertaken.
- Section 17 requires the IDPH Licensed Lead Supervisor ID#. Enter it accurately to reflect the supervisor overseeing the project.
- In Section 18, write the Lead Supervisor's Name, ensuring it aligns with the accompanying certification.
- Section 19 requires the Signature of the Contractor’s Contact Person; this must be the individual listed on the license application.
- Complete Sections 20 and 21 by entering the Telephone and Fax numbers for the Contractor’s Contact Person.
- Once all sections are completed, review the entire form for accuracy and completeness, making any necessary corrections.
